All-Party Parliamentary Group on Modern Conflict

Purpose

The APPG is an interest group for parliamentarians considering the capabilities and commitments driving contemporary warfare. Our work advances discussion and policy-making regarding protection considerations, technology, covert operations, and other issues which are outpacing conventional oversight mechanisms in the context of modern conflict.
